Tribe Flatoidini Melichar, 1901
Key to the American genera of Flatoidinae
1. Lateral margin of forewing distinctly undulate.............................................................. 2
–. Lateral margin of forewing not undulate................................................................... 4
2. From dorsal view apical margin of the pronotum convex, apex of the head weakly convex....................................................................................... Phalaenomorpha Amyot & Audinet-Serville, 1843
–. From dorsal view apical margin of the pronotum pointed, apex of the head weakly pointed.......................... 4
3. Length of vertex twice the width between eyes......................................... Atracodes Melichar, 1902 View in CoL
–. Length of vertex as long as width between eyes.................................. Flatarissa Metcalf & Bruner, 1948 View in CoL
4. Head distinctly pointed at apex..................................................... Flatoidinus Melichar, 1923 View in CoL
–. Head distinctly truncate at apex......................................................................... 5
5. 1 lateral spine on hind tibiae (sometimes 2, check both legs)................................. Metcracis Medler, 1993 View in CoL
–. 2 or three lateral spines on hind tibiae..................................................................... 6
6. 2 lateral spines on hind tibiae, occurring outside Cuba.................................... Flataloides Metcalf, 1938 View in CoL
–. 3 lateral spines on hind tibiae, occurring in Cuba.................................. Flatarina Metcalf & Bruner, 1948 View in CoL
